环境:
Struts1,poolmanjdbc封装组件,oracle12c 集群,was服务器
旧系统升级:oracle驱动使用的是jdbc14.jar
应用发布后报数据连接异常:please checked your username,password connectivity info.
解决办法:
1.poolman.xml中的数据库连接url为:
1)sid连接:jdbc:oracle:thin@:ip:port:sid
2)service_name集群:jdbc:oracle:thin:@(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.16.0.1)(PORT = 1521))
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.16.0.2)(PORT = 1521))
(FAILOVER=yes)
(LOAD_BALANCE =yes)
)
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)
2.更新oracle驱动为ojdbc6.jar.
发布程序正常访问,问题解决。
Oracle 版本 jdk版本 推荐jar包 备注
Oracle 8i JDK 1.1.x classes111.zip
Oracle 8i JDK 1.1.x classes12.zip 这个版本是有classes12.jar的,可以尝试下载
Oracle 9i JDK 1.1.x classes111.jar 或者 classes111.zip
Oracle 9i JDK 1.2 and JDK 1.3 classes12.jar 或者 classes12.zip
Oracle 9i JDK 1.4 ojdbc14.jar
Oracle 9i JDK 1.5 ojdbc5.jar Oracle 9i JDK 1.6 ojdbc6.jar
Oracle 10g JDK 1.2 and JDK 1.3. classes12.jar
Oracle 10g JDK 1.4 and 5.0 ojdbc14.jar
Oracle 11g jdk5 ojdbc5.jar
Oracle 11g jdk6 ojdbc6.jar
Oracle 12c jdk6 ojdbc6.jar
上述orcle版本和jdbc驱动的对应关系仅供参考。
Struts1,poolmanjdbc封装组件,oracle12c 集群,was服务器
旧系统升级:oracle驱动使用的是jdbc14.jar
应用发布后报数据连接异常:please checked your username,password connectivity info.
解决办法:
1.poolman.xml中的数据库连接url为:
1)sid连接:jdbc:oracle:thin@:ip:port:sid
2)service_name集群:jdbc:oracle:thin:@(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.16.0.1)(PORT = 1521))
(ADDRESS = (PROTOCOL = TCP)(HOST = 172.16.0.2)(PORT = 1521))
(FAILOVER=yes)
(LOAD_BALANCE =yes)
)
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)
2.更新oracle驱动为ojdbc6.jar.
发布程序正常访问,问题解决。
Oracle 版本 jdk版本 推荐jar包 备注
Oracle 8i JDK 1.1.x classes111.zip
Oracle 8i JDK 1.1.x classes12.zip 这个版本是有classes12.jar的,可以尝试下载
Oracle 9i JDK 1.1.x classes111.jar 或者 classes111.zip
Oracle 9i JDK 1.2 and JDK 1.3 classes12.jar 或者 classes12.zip
Oracle 9i JDK 1.4 ojdbc14.jar
Oracle 9i JDK 1.5 ojdbc5.jar Oracle 9i JDK 1.6 ojdbc6.jar
Oracle 10g JDK 1.2 and JDK 1.3. classes12.jar
Oracle 10g JDK 1.4 and 5.0 ojdbc14.jar
Oracle 11g jdk5 ojdbc5.jar
Oracle 11g jdk6 ojdbc6.jar
Oracle 12c jdk6 ojdbc6.jar
上述orcle版本和jdbc驱动的对应关系仅供参考。
本文介绍了一个基于Struts1的应用在Oracle12c集群环境下遇到的数据连接异常问题及解决方案,包括正确的数据库连接URL配置和服务名集群设置,并推荐了对应的JDBC驱动版本。
1634

被折叠的 条评论
为什么被折叠?



